Libbeys Good News Gift Shop Category Shopping Claimed 77 E State St Sherrill NY 13461 (315) 361-5323 Get Directions View Details
Hotaling Imports Category Shopping Claimed 80 E Seneca St Sherrill NY 13461 (315) 363-4923 Get Directions View Details